Theory tests restarted in England on 4 July 2020 - update

11 Jul 2020

Social distancing and safety precautions are in place for theory tests.

Change made to guidance:

Updated the guide to make it clear that theory tests are still suspended in areas under local lockdown in England. Updated the section about when you must not come for your theory test to explain that from 10 July, you will not have to self-isolate if you’re arriving in England from a country or territory on the travel corridors list.
